How do I upload my photos to ZoomIn?

Once you've signed up as a ZoomIn member, uploading photos to your account is simple:

Your First Time Uploading:

  1. Sign in to your ZoomIn user account
  2. Click on the "Create your new Album" button
  3. Choose a name for your Album
  4. Click the "Browse" button and choose the photos you'd like to upload from your Computer
  5. You can select multiple photos from your Computer by simply dragging the selection or pressing shift or ctrl
  6. Once you have selected your photos click the "Upload" button

All Future Uploads:

  1. Sign in to your ZoomIn user account
  2. From the "My Albums" page, click the "Add New Album" tab
  3. Select "Create new Album" and type in a name for your Album OR choose to add photos to an existing Album by selecting that Album from the drop-down
  4. Click the "Upload Photos" button
  5. Click the "Browse" button and choose the photos you'd like to upload from your Computer
  6. You can select multiple photos from your Computer by simply dragging the selection or pressing shift or ctrl
  7. Once you have selected your photos click the "Upload" button

How long does it take to upload photos?

There are many factors that influence upload time, including the speed of your connection and the size of your photos. The faster your Internet connection, the less time it will take to upload your photos. During the upload process we will provide you with an "Estimated time left" for your upload. Remember - do not leave the upload page while the upload is in progress. Clicking on any link or button on that page will interrupt the upload.

How do I enable Javascript in my browser?

ZoomIn requires JavaScript to be enabled for upload to work correctly. If you receive a message that you need to enable Javascript follow the steps below for your browser:

Internet Explorer 6 and 7

Select Tools | Internet Options… menu item from the main menu. Change to the Security tab at the top of the Internet Options window that pops up. From the list of zones at the top of the Security options select the internet icon. Select the button near the bottom that reads Custom Level. In the new window that pops up, scroll down to the item that reads Active Scripting. Select the option marked Enable.

Mozilla Firefox 1.5 and 2.0

Select Tools | Options... from the main menu. Select Content button from the top row of options. Select "Enable JavaScript." (You do not need to enable Java, but it is OK if you do.)

Safari

Select Preferences from the Safari menu. Select Security tab at the top. Make sure "Enable JavaScript" is checked.

How can I import my photos from Flickr?

ZoomIn provides you with an easy way to bring your Flickr photos into your ZoomIn account:

  1. Sign in to your ZoomIn user account
  2. From the "My Albums" page click on the "Import from Flickr" link
  3. When prompted, sign in to your Flickr account
  4. Choose the sets you would like imported to ZoomIn and click the "Import" button
